Course content |
1. Sensor characteristics. 2. Mechanical sensors. 3. Thermal sensors 4. Other non-electical sensors.
|
Learning activities and teaching methods |
Lecture |
Learning outcomes |
The point is explanation of physical principles of non-electric sensors, with theirs technical properties, construction and posibilities od usage for various quantities measurement. Within the general introduction, student is informed in addition with the stucture of measurement systems and theirs static and dynamic properties.
1 knowledge List the basic division of sensors according to the principle. Describe and compare individual physical principles of sensors, theirs basic properties, construction and usage. |
